Output abf77c2c21d176ac9b9d4e4a0f61df9dcef33dce0d8a2b079b61cda819b5da62:1

value
998711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d37344f26c3095f43a655628032d5f1fa84e5cf OP_EQUAL
address
3D76XBnnLeYBm6vBBrVuPtNjnFhG8XZ4sz
transaction
abf77c2c21d176ac9b9d4e4a0f61df9dcef33dce0d8a2b079b61cda819b5da62
confirmations
396629
spent
true